It was on the 14th of March that General Sherman received notice from General Grant that he (General Grant), had been commissioned Lieutenant-General and Commander-in-chief of the armies of the United States-an appointment which would compel him to go east, and that he (General Sherman), had been appointed to succeed him as commander of the Mississippi. Immediately thereafter, General Sherman began a tour of inspection, visiting Athens, Decatur, Huntsville, Chattanooga, Knoxville, and other military points within his new command. The new commander, in this preliminary tour of observation, had interviews with Major-General McPherson, commanding the Army of the Tennessee, at Huntsville, with Major-General Thomas, commanding the Army of the Cumberland, at Chattanooga, and with Major-General Schofield, commanding the army of the Ohio, at Knoxville.
